32 Alma Street West

    32, ALMA STREET WEST, CHESTERFIELD, S40 2AX

    This terraced freehold property on Alma Street West last sold in August 2024 for £80,000. Based on price growth in the S40 district since then, its estimated current value is £79,754 — placing it in the 2nd percentile nationally and the 2nd percentile within S40. The property covers 64 m² (689 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£1,246 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of C.
